Can you please help with this sentence equation on equalities?
8 is greater than or equal to a number m.

Respuesta :

kaydeq21006 kaydeq21006
  • 21-09-2020

Answer:

8 ≥ m

Step-by-step explanation:

8 ≥ m is read as 8 is greater than or equal to m.

8, being the larger quantity is by the opening, showing it is greater than m. The underlined part represents m could also be equal to 8.

m could equal 8 or anything below the number 8.
